Output 1e8c8b34dde5663549aa61da8df5f8b5e3b95c0eaac0eec77cd9c4cd3f6eb030:1

value
689325420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66f0846191a27dd757966715c5861a63ee63a4d7 OP_EQUALVERIFY OP_CHECKSIG
address
1APJ3zM7uyqrS9NGj2YHLK3Rowqn78Dx2B
transaction
1e8c8b34dde5663549aa61da8df5f8b5e3b95c0eaac0eec77cd9c4cd3f6eb030
confirmations
522365
spent
true